JE Cleantech Holdings Limited Business Introduction

JE Cleantech Holdings Limited (Nasdaq: JCSE) is a Singapore-based company primarily engaged in the design, development, manufacture, and sale of cleaning systems, as well as providing central dishwashing and auxiliary services. The company has evolved from a precision engineering firm into a diversified environmental technology and services provider.

1. Detailed Business Modules

Cleaning Systems Manufacturing: This is the core industrial arm of the company. JE Cleantech designs and builds customized large-scale industrial cleaning systems, including ultrasonic cleaning, high-pressure spray cleaning, and automated drying systems. These are primarily sold to manufacturers in the hard disk drive (HDD), semiconductor, and electronics industries.

Central Dishwashing Services: The company operates large-scale central dishwashing facilities in Singapore. They provide outsourced dishwashing, collection, and delivery services for Food and Beverage (F&B) establishments, including hawker centers, food courts, and restaurants. This business provides a stable, recurring revenue stream.

General Cleaning Services: Beyond dishwashing, the company offers commercial cleaning services for public and private spaces, leveraging their expertise in hygiene and sanitation technology.

2. Business Model Characteristics

Vertical Integration: JE Cleantech controls the entire value chain for its cleaning systems—from engineering design to manufacturing—allowing for high customization and quality control.

Revenue Diversification: By combining one-off high-value industrial equipment sales with long-term, high-frequency service contracts (dishwashing), the company balances capital expenditure volatility with operational cash flow stability.

Regulatory Compliance: Operating in Singapore’s highly regulated environmental and food safety sector, the company adheres to strict NEA (National Environment Agency) standards, creating a high barrier to entry for smaller competitors.

3. Core Competitive Moat

Technological Expertise: Over 20 years of experience in precision engineering and ultrasonic cleaning technology provides a technical advantage in serving high-tech manufacturing sectors.

Strategic Asset Ownership: The ownership of centralized, automated dishwashing facilities is a significant moat, as setting up such facilities requires substantial capital and specific government licensing in land-scarce Singapore.

4. Latest Strategic Layout

According to the latest 2024 and early 2025 financial disclosures, the company is focusing on Automation and Green Technology. They are investing in AI-driven sorting systems for their dishwashing lines to reduce labor dependency and exploring sustainable water recycling technologies to lower the environmental impact of their cleaning processes.

JE Cleantech Holdings Limited Development History

The journey of JE Cleantech is marked by a transition from a specialized engineering workshop to a publicly traded international entity.

1. Phase 1: Founding and Niche Focus (1999 – 2005)

The company was founded in Singapore in 1999, initially focusing on providing precision cleaning systems for the booming HDD and electronics sectors. During this period, the company established its reputation for reliability and technical competence among multinational corporations operating in Southeast Asia.

2. Phase 2: Service Diversification (2006 – 2015)

Recognizing the cyclical nature of the electronics industry, the management diversified into the services sector. In 2013, the company officially entered the central dishwashing market, capitalizing on the Singapore government's push for productivity and hygiene in the F&B sector through the use of centralized services.

3. Phase 3: Scaling and Public Listing (2016 – 2022)

The company consolidated its operations and expanded its facility footprint. In April 2022, JE Cleantech successfully listed on the Nasdaq Capital Market under the ticker "JCSE." This move was aimed at raising capital to modernize its fleet and expand its technological capabilities.

4. Phase 4: Modernization and Resilience (2023 – Present)

Post-listing, the company has faced a challenging macroeconomic environment. However, it has focused on optimizing its "Asset-Light" service model and upgrading its industrial cleaning equipment to support the growing semiconductor demand in the region.

5. Success Factors and Challenges

Success Reason: Successful adaptation to government-led initiatives in Singapore (such as the Productivity Solutions Grant) helped the company secure early-mover advantages in the centralized dishwashing market.

Challenges: High reliance on the labor market in Singapore and fluctuations in the global electronics demand have occasionally pressured margins, leading to a focus on automation to mitigate rising labor costs.

Industry Introduction

JE Cleantech operates at the intersection of the Industrial Cleaning Equipment market and the Environmental Services market.

1. Industry Trends and Catalysts

Labor Scarcity: In developed markets like Singapore, the rising cost of manual labor is a primary catalyst for the adoption of automated cleaning and dishwashing solutions.

Semiconductor Resurgence: The global push for AI and high-performance computing has led to increased investment in semiconductor fabrication plants (Fabs). These facilities require ultra-high-precision cleaning systems, driving demand for JE Cleantech’s industrial products.

2. Competition Landscape

Market Segment Key Competitors Competitive Dynamic
Industrial Cleaning Systems U.S. and Japanese Engineering Firms Focus on high-end customization and precision.
Central Dishwashing (SG) Great Solutions, GS Cleaning Localized competition based on logistics and pricing.
Environmental Services 800 Super, Veolia (Asia) Large-scale waste management and cleaning conglomerates.

3. Industry Position

JE Cleantech holds a significant niche position in Singapore. While it is a "Small-Cap" entity on the Nasdaq, it is one of the few integrated providers in Singapore that combines high-end manufacturing with essential public hygiene services. As of 2024, the company remains a key beneficiary of Singapore's Smart Nation and sustainability initiatives, positioning it as a specialized player in the regional "Green Economy."

JCSE Development Potential

Latest Strategic Roadmap

JE Cleantech is pivoting from a traditional equipment manufacturer to a technology-driven "Cleantech" solutions provider. The company's roadmap focuses on automation and robotics within the precision cleaning sector. In 2026, the company reported securing approximately USD$12 million in new orders for precision cleaning systems, which are expected to be delivered progressively through 2027, providing a stable revenue pipeline.

Asset Optimization and Capital Return

A significant catalyst for shareholder value has been the monetization of non-core assets. In early 2026, the company completed the sale of its industrial property at 17 Woodlands Sector 1 for approximately S$7.39 million, resulting in a net gain of S$3.70 million. This liquidity event triggered a substantial special cash dividend of US$0.44 per share in January 2026, highlighting management's commitment to returning capital during periods of asset restructuring.

Expansion in Centralized Services

The centralized dishwashing and ancillary services segment remains a steady recurring revenue stream. While equipment sales are often order-based and lumpy, the services segment provides a buffer. The company is actively looking to integrate deep-tech cleaning robots to improve margins in this labor-intensive sector, aiming to mitigate rising operational costs in its primary Singapore market.


JE Cleantech Holdings Limited Pros and Risks

Pros (Upside Factors)

  • Strong Order Book: The recent win of USD$12 million in new orders (Q1 2026) indicates sustained demand from key industrial customers for mission-critical cleaning systems.
  • Asset-Light Strategy: By selling industrial properties and focusing on high-margin engineering and services, the company is improving its balance sheet flexibility.
  • High Dividend Yield: Recent special dividends have placed JCSE among the top dividend payers in its sector, although these are currently tied to one-off asset sales.
  • Operational Recovery: Unaudited forecasts for 2025 suggest a sharp turnaround in net income (approaching S$3.9 million), potentially ending a period of marginal profitability.

Risks (Downside Factors)

  • Revenue Concentration: A significant portion of revenue is derived from a limited number of "key customers" in the precision cleaning segment; the loss of one major contract could severely impact top-line growth.
  • Filing Delays: The company has recently experienced delays in filing its annual Form 20-F reports (noted in April 2025 and April 2026), which can lead to regulatory scrutiny and reduced investor confidence.
  • Market Volatility: As a small-cap stock listed on the Nasdaq, JCSE is subject to high price volatility and has previously struggled with minimum bid price requirements.
  • Cost Sensitivity: Fluctuations in the prices of raw materials such as stainless steel and electronic components can squeeze margins, especially on fixed-price equipment contracts.
